Douglas Laing

Established in 1948, Douglas Laing is a leading independent blender and bottler specialising in the creation of artisan, small batch and Single Cask Scotch Whiskies. Hand-selected from the finest, and often rarest stocks available throughout Scotland, their Whisky is offered to you as the Distiller intended: At high alcohol strength and proudly without chill filtration or added colour.
